The MicroHUD heads-up display combines with a belt-worn mobiel computer for law enforcement applications featuring true virtual image display. The system offers a Microsoft Windows CE.NET mobile operating system, a unique combination of worldwide cellular network wireless data and voice connectivity. This system gives motor officers wireless access to the same CAD and NCIC database information that normally is only available on squad car laptop computers. Motor officers can wirelessly connect to CAD servers to run plates, check unit status and file reports. Incoming or outgoing cellular voice phone calls can also be made using the standard helmet headset without removing the helmet. The battery-operated system, which can flip out of the way when the display is not needed, fits to 1/2 and 3/4 style helmets and baseball caps.
